East Coast failure sees National Express lose another franchise
26th November 2009
TRANSPORT group National Express has paid the price for pulling out of running the East Coast Main Line rail route with the Government announcing that it will have its East Anglia rail franchise terminated three years early.
The Department for Transport said National Express would lose the franchise on March 31, 2011.
